L3 Technologies is a prime contractor in Command, Control, Communications,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ance (C 3 ISR) systems market and a leading provider of a broad range of electronic systems used on both military and commercial platforms. Our customers include the U.S. Department of Defense and its prime contractors, U.S. Government intelligence agencies, the U.S. Department of Homeland Security, allied foreign governments, domestic and foreign commercial customers and select other U.S. federal, state and local government agencies.

Organized into 3 segments – Electronic Systems, Communications Systems and Intelligence Surveillance and Reconnaissance (ISR) Systems – L3 Technologies employs over 31,000 people worldwide with reported 2017 sales of $9.5 billion.

L3 MariPro specializes in providing undersea sensor networks, and spread spectrum through water communication solutions. We are a system concept-through-operations company with extensive experience in responding to demanding customer requirements. Job Summary:

The Senior Software Engineer is responsible for the development of computer software along with commercial off-the-shelf (COTS) hardware that is configured as special purpose test equipment to monitor operation of the data acquisition hardware. The test equipment may be configured to operate in many different environments including, OEM factory test equipment, depot and maintenance operations, laboratory analysis, aboard ship, etc.
